We are looking for a Cost Accountant to support accurate financial reporting for manufacturing operations in Indianapolis, Indiana. This position focuses on evaluating production costs, interpreting cost data, and helping the business maintain sound accounting practices within a manufacturing environment serving the aviation and travel sector. The role requires strong knowledge of percentage-of-completion and completed-contract accounting, along with an understanding of revenue recognition guidance and core manufacturing cost drivers.Responsibilities:• Analyze manufacturing cost activity to ensure labor, material, and overhead are recorded accurately and reported in a timely manner.• Prepare cost reports and variance analyses that highlight performance trends, production inefficiencies, and areas requiring financial review.• Apply over-time and completed-contract accounting treatment appropriately based on the nature of products and services provided.• Support revenue and cost recognition in alignment with ASC 606, contractual terms, and applicable shipping considerations such as Incoterms.• Review production orders, bills of materials, and inventory transactions to confirm the integrity of standard and actual cost data.• Partner with operations and finance teams to monitor inventory movements, cycle counts, and physical inventory results, resolving discrepancies when identified.• Maintain and refine standard costing processes to improve visibility into product profitability and manufacturing performance.• Assist with monthly and year-end close activities related to inventory valuation, cost allocations, and manufacturing financial reporting.
